Bush Tetras Return with First New Album in 11 Years 'They Live in My Head'

Hear "Things I Put Together" from the Steve Shelley-produced LP

BY Calum SlingerlandPublished May 4, 2023

Bush Tetras have returned with their first new album in 11 years. The NYC post-punk outfit will share They Live in My Head on July 28 via Wharf Cat Records.

Produced by Sonic Youth's Steve Shelley — who also drums on the album — They Live in My Head follows Bush Tetras' 2012 sophomore LP Happy. The band, formed in 1979, had their work revisited in recent years with the 2021 arrival of box set Rhythm and Paranoia: The Best of Bush Tetras.

In tandem with the box set, the lineup of vocalist Cynthia Sley, guitarist Pat Place and drummer Dee Pop began work on a new album. Right before its release, Pop passed away, leaving his bandmates determined to complete the LP in his honour.

In a release, Place shares of working with Shelley, "We just went into the rehearsal space and things just would fall right into place. We'd just start playing and the next thing would happen and we'd know where to take it."

Sley added of the album: "We thought a lot about memories from 1979 in New York City. It's a reflection of growing up together, what we were eating, what we were doing, weird little things people probably won't get. But that's cool."

"Things I Put Together" is the first song to arrive from They Live in My Head, and you can hear it below. Bush Tetras have lined up a pair of US shows to mark the album's release, with a release hinting at "further dates to come in the US and Europe."

Bush Tetras' presently scheduled live dates will see Rocky O'Riordan (The Pogues, the Radiators, Elvis Costello & the Attractions) join the group to play bass alongside Sley, Place and Shelley.
